Our research interest includes POROUS metal organic frameworks (MOFs), POROUS covalent organic frameworks (COFs) and POROUS H-Bonded Organic Frameworks (HOFs) for their potential applications in gas storage (energy storage) such as CH4, H2 and CO2 capture and storage (CCS), gas separations including hydrocarbon separation, sensing materials, heterogeneous catalysis, enantioselective separation, small achiral molecules separation, electrochemical energy storage and proton conducting membranes for fuel cell application.
